Funciones matemáticas

Aprenda a utilizar funciones matemáticas en el editor de expresiones.

Absoluta

La variable absolute se utiliza para convertir un número que es un valor absoluto.

Sintaxis

{%= absolute(int) %}: int

formatNumber

La variable formatNumber se utiliza para dar formato a cualquier número en su representación que distingue entre idiomas.

Acepta un número y una cadena que representan la configuración regional y devuelve una cadena formateada del número en la configuración regional deseada.

Sintaxis

{%= formatNumber(number/double,string) %}: string

Puede utilizar el formato y las configuraciones regionales válidas, como se resume en documentación de oracle y Localizaciones compatibles

Ejemplo

Esta consulta devuelve una cadena con formato en árabe que corresponde a 123456.789 como número de entrada.

{%= formatNumber(123456.789, "ar_EG") %}

Aleatorio

La variable random se utiliza para devolver un valor aleatorio entre 0 y 1.

Sintaxis

{%= random() %}: double

Redondear hacia abajo

La variable roundDown para redondear hacia abajo un número.

Sintaxis

{%= roundDown(double) %}: double

Redondear hacia arriba

La variable Count only null se utiliza redondeando un número.

Sintaxis

{%= roundUp(double) %}: double

A cadena hexadecimal

La variable toHexString convierte cualquier número en su cadena hexadecimal.

Sintaxis

{%= toHexString(number) %}: string

Ejemplo

Esta consulta devuelve el valor hexadecimal de 158, es decir, 9e.

{%= toHexString(158) %}

A porcentaje

La variable toPercentage para convertir un número en porcentaje.

Sintaxis

{%= toPercentage(double) %}: string

Para precisión

La variable toPrecision para convertir un número a la precisión necesaria.

Sintaxis

{%= toPrecision(double,int) %}: string

A cadena

La variable toString convierte cualquier número en su representación de cadena.

Sintaxis

{%= toString(string) %}: string

Ejemplo

Esta consulta devuelve "12".

{%= toString(12) %}

En esta página